What clinical reality significantly increases adherence complexity, driving the need for smart pillboxes?
Answer
Polypharmacy
The necessity for advanced tools like the smart pillbox arises directly from the clinical reality known as polypharmacy. Polypharmacy refers to the situation where a patient is required to use multiple medications simultaneously to manage various chronic conditions. This simultaneous management significantly escalates the overall complexity of maintaining adherence to all prescribed schedules and dosages. Smart pillboxes address this by incorporating features such as knowing exactly which compartment was opened and when, alongside connectivity and logging, providing a structured solution for managing these complex regimens.
